Another mouthguard push from your resident dentite :) The research shows that a custom fitted, laminated mouth guard offers the best protection while also being the most comfortable. Think you dont need one because theres no striking in BJJ? Then remember the last time you rolled a spazzy white belt, (like me), who accidentally elbowed you in the face, or smashed your lower jaw into your upper teeth. A mouth guard is s very cheap insurance policy against potentially expensive dental fix-ups. Crack a back tooth which then needs root canal therapy and a crown? $3k.
